What should I bring to my first consultation with an immigration attorney in Cuddebackville?
You should bring all relevant documents, which typically include your passport, I-94 arrival/departure record, any prior immigration applications or notices (like Receipt Notices or Denial Letters from USCIS), and any correspondence from immigration courts or ICE. If your case is family-based, bring birth certificates, marriage certificates, and proof of your sponsor's financial status. For work-based cases, bring employment letters and prior visa approvals. Having a complete set of documents helps an Orange County attorney accurately assess your case and navigate the specific requirements of the relevant USCIS Service Center or local office processing your application.
How does living in a rural area like Cuddebackville, NY affect the immigration process?
Living in a rural hamlet like Cuddebackville primarily affects logistical aspects. While immigration is federal law, you will likely need to travel for biometrics appointments, interviews, or court hearings. Key locations include the USCIS Application Support Center in Newburgh for fingerprints, the USCIS Field Office in Manhattan or Albany for interviews, and potentially the Immigration Court in Buffalo for removal proceedings. A local attorney can help prepare you for these trips and manage communication with these distant offices. Furthermore, your attorney may need to address how your ties to the Cuddebackville community can support applications demonstrating good moral character or strong family connections.
